A Journey Through Indonesia

The Ultimate Three Weeks in Indonesia

Discover Indonesia on the ultimate three-week journey through sacred temples, wild seas, and island sanctuaries.

Begin in Bali on the tranquil east coast at Amankila, where Mount Agung rises behind palm-fringed beaches and days unfold with spa rituals, private boat excursions, and a traditional Melukat water blessing led by a local priest.

Candlelit dinners overlooking rice fields, snorkelling from a Balinese fishing boat, and jungle-wrapped serenity set the tone before travelling inland to Ubud. Here, cycling through emerald UNESCO-listed rice terraces, riverside yoga, artisan villages, and standout dining reveal Bali’s cultural and spiritual heart.

Fly on to Central Java for an unforgettable stay at Amanjiwo, gazing directly over Borobudur. Explore this ancient Buddhist monument at dawn, trek the mystical Menoreh Hills, and cycle through rural villages before sharing an intimate, home-cooked Javanese dinner accompanied by gamelan music. The journey then shifts dramatically to the seas of Komodo National Park, where three nights aboard a private yacht bring snorkelling with manta rays, encounters with Komodo dragons, coral-rich dives, sunset beach dinners, and starlit barbecues in some of Indonesia’s most remote waters.

The adventure ends on the untamed island of Sumba at Nihi Sumba, a place of sweeping beaches, rolling savannahs, and deep cultural connection. Ride horses through the surf at sunset, hike to hidden waterfalls, surf legendary breaks, and unwind on a secluded spa safari overlooking the Indian Ocean. Days are unhurried and immersive, blending nature, wellness, and meaningful encounters with local communities—an extraordinary finale to a meticulously curated Indonesian escape.

DID YOU KNOW?

Indonesia is the world’s largest archipelago, made up of over 17,000 islands, many formed by volcanic activity. Sitting on the Pacific Ring of Fire, it has around 130 active volcanoes, the most of any country, and in some regions, the Indian and Pacific Oceans meet, creating spectacular coastal scenery.

Bongkasa Cycling

Four Seasons, Ubud, Bali

Cycle through Bali’s peaceful interior, where emerald paddy fields, village temples and traditional houses line the route. The ride unfolds at an easy pace, with time to pause, meet locals and glimpse daily life beyond Ubud.

The journey ends at Puri Taman Sari, a Balinese compound owned by the Mengwi royal family, where a home-cooked lunch is served. Later, wander through Taman Ayun, the 17th-century royal temple of Mengwi and part of Bali’s UNESCO-recognised Subak irrigation system, set within a wide moat and layered courtyards crowned with tiered meru shrines.

Borobudur at dawn

Borobudur Temple, Java, Indonesia

Rise early to experience Borobudur at dawn. Built in the 9th century, this UNESCO World Heritage Site is one of Southeast Asia’s man-made marvels, made even more magical for Amanjiwo guests with early access before the crowds. Later, wander the mystical Menoreh Hills, where Prince Diponegoro once sought spiritual guidance and locals continue to come in search of insight.

Hiking or Mountain-Biking to Nearby Waterfalls

Nihi Sumba, Indonesia

Hike or mountain-bike to nearby waterfalls, passing incredible birdlife along the way. Sumba is home to over 300 species, including eight found nowhere else, such as hornbills, fruit doves, button quail and paradise flycatchers.
